On average across the year,
no, Palmdale, California is not hotter than
Redlands, California
.
Palmdale, California has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Redlands, California has an average temperature of 20°C/68°F.
Palmdale, California's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is not hotter than Redlands, California's hottest month (also August, with an average maximum temperature of 35°C/95°F).
On average across the year, yes, Palmdale, California is colder than Redlands, California . Palmdale, California has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F and Redlands, California has an average minimum temperature of 13°C/55°F.
